Tree Limbs Removal in Pottstown, PA
Tree limbs removal services focus on safely trimming or removing overgrown, damaged, or hazardous branches from trees on residential properties. This service is often requested to improve the health and appearance of trees, prevent potential property damage from falling limbs, or to clear space for construction or landscaping projects.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, including which branches will be removed, the safety measures in place, and how the process might impact the overall health of the tree.
Before requesting tree limbs removal, homeowners should consider the condition of their trees and identify any limbs that pose a risk to structures, power lines, or people. It’s important to communicate any specific concerns, such as removing limbs obstructing views or pathways. Understanding the extent of trimming needed and any potential effects on the tree’s growth can help ensure the project meets safety and aesthetic goals.

Common Tree Limbs Removal Jobs
Tree Limb Removal - removes hazardous or damaged branches to improve tree health and safety.
Storm Damage Cleanup - clears fallen or broken limbs after storms to prevent property damage.
Overhanging Limb Trimming - reduces overhanging branches that pose risks to structures or power lines.
Selective Limb Pruning - carefully trims specific limbs to promote healthy growth and maintain appearance.
Emergency Limb Removal - quickly addresses urgent limb issues that threaten safety or property.
Tree Crown Thinning - reduces limb density to improve airflow and sunlight penetration through the canopy.
Tree Limbs Removal Questions
Why should tree limbs be removed? Removing overhanging or damaged limbs reduces the risk of falling and property damage during storms or high winds.
What types of tree limbs are typically removed? Dead, diseased, broken, or hazardous limbs are commonly removed to maintain tree health and safety.
How does limb removal benefit my property? It improves safety, prevents damage to structures, and promotes healthier tree growth.
Is limb removal necessary for all trees? Not all trees require limb removal; it depends on the tree’s condition and potential hazards.
